Decades Costumes (Page 3)
121 - 145 of 145
121 - 145 of 145







£14.99

£13.99

£14.99

£35.99

Made By Us
Exclusive


£53.99


£8.99


£22.99



Made By Us
Exclusive
£8.99

£8.99

£8.99

Made By Us
Exclusive
£13.99


Filter
